Product Description:
1-Nitropentane is primarily used in organic synthesis as a solvent and intermediate in the production of various chemical compounds. It is often employed in research and industrial settings for the preparation of nitroalkanes, which are valuable in the development of pharmaceuticals, agrochemicals, and specialty chemicals. Additionally, its properties make it suitable for use in fuel additives and as a component in certain types of explosives. In laboratory settings, it serves as a reagent for studying nitration reactions and other organic transformations. Its application is also explored in the field of material science for modifying polymer properties and in the synthesis of complex organic molecules.
